CVE-2006-5839 describes a remote file inclusion vulnerability in PHPAdventure 1.1-Alpha and earlier, specifically within the ad_main.php script. This flaw allows unauthenticated remote attackers to execute arbitrary PHP code by manipulating the _mygamefile parameter. With a CVSS score of 7.5, this vulnerability is considered highly severe due to its low attack complexity and potential for complete compromise of confidentiality, integrity, and availability. While not listed on the KEV catalog or showing active exploitation, public exploit code exists on ExploitDB, and it has garnered minimal community discussion or media coverage.
